I'm looking to use Inventor 3D models in manufacturing. In a step to achieve this we will be modelling to Mid size, therefore using the ‘Median’ option in dimension properties, then select the appropriate fit.
The problem I have encountered is when creating the 2D Drawing.
When ‘retrieve dimensions’ is used, there is no issue, the nominal dimension is displayed with the selected fit driven by the model. The problem occurs when I dimension the part manually and apply the same fit, this dimension will be driven from the actual model size – which is the mid dimension.
Is there any way round this? Where, if the drawing is being dimensioned manually it will calculate the tolerance from the nominal size?

Set the model tolerance to nominal, then you will get the same thing using drawing dimensions.
Of course this will change the size of the model to the nomimal size specified in the model dimension.
I use the retrieved dimensions from the model, they will show the same regardless of the size (except for the underline).
